Description
Garlic Butter Beef Bites and Potatoes is a delectable and comforting dish that combines tender beef, buttery garlic, and baby potatoes into a hearty meal perfect for busy weeknights or cozy gatherings.
Ingredients
- 2 pound beef stew meat
- 2 cup baby potatoes, halved
- 1/2 cup unsalted butter
- 4 cloves garlic, minced
- 1 teaspoon onion powder
- 1 teaspoon smoked paprika
- 1 teaspoon dried thyme
- 1 teaspoon salt
- 1/2 teaspoon black pepper
- 1 cup beef broth
- 2 tablespoon olive oil
Instructions
1. In a skillet over medium-high heat, add the olive oil and sear the beef bites until they’re nicely browned on all sides.
2. Transfer the seared beef bites to the slow cooker and add the halved baby potatoes.
3. In a small bowl, combine the melted butter, minced garlic, onion powder, smoked paprika, dried thyme, salt, and black pepper.
4. Pour the garlic butter mixture over the beef and potatoes, then add the beef broth.
5. Cover the slow cooker and cook on low for 6-8 hours or on high for 3-4 hours, until the beef is tender and the potatoes are cooked through.
6. Spoon the Garlic Butter Beef Bites and Potatoes onto plates and garnish with fresh parsley if desired.
Notes
Choose well-marbled beef for tenderness.
Adjust cooking time based on slow cooker settings.
Feel free to add vegetables like carrots or green beans for a complete meal.
